Ukrainian Easter Eggs (with Grandma's Secrets)
This simple, organic Ukrainian Easter eggs guide only requires eggs, onion skins, herbs and stockings. The old world way to decorate your eggs all natural!

Ingredients
- 12 white eggs
- 3 cups onion skins
- 5 quarts water
- 1 tbsp salt
- 1 tbsp herb leaves cilantro or parsley
- 1/4 cup olive oil
Instructions
- Place the onion skins in a large pot with the salt and water. Bring them to a boil, then reduce the heat to medium-low and allow the skins to simmer for 10 minutes to extract the color.
- To create a stencil with the herbs, wrap the herbs around an egg. Place the egg inside the nylons and tie a knot. If you are decorating multiple eggs, make sure to tie a knot in between each to secure the herbs against the egg.
- Bring the water to a boil and add the nylon-wrapped eggs to the water, making sure the eggs are fully submerged.
- Remove the eggs from the boiling water and allow them to cool down. Remove the nylon and herbs.
- To make the eggs shiny, brush them with oil. Hide them and enjoy!
